Sensex closes at 34,981; Nifty closes at 10,763

The Sensex gave up all its early gains and ended lower for the third straight session by falling over 200 points due to selling in metal, PSU, auto and banking stocks. However the rupee witnessed a big jump of 77 paise against the US dollar amid ease in brent crude prices. The Sensex at the Bombay Stock Exchange today witnessed fall amid fresh fund outflows and a weak trend in the global market. It fell 219 points, to end below 35,000 mark at 34,981. Benchmark domestic stocks witnessed losses in afternoon trade amid mixed Asian share markets

Benchmark domestic stocks today witnessed losses in afternoon trade amid mixed Asian share markets. The Sensex at the Bombay Stock Exchange fell 77 points, or 0.24 percent to 33,990 in intra-day trade a short while ago.  The Nifty at National Stock Exchange also slipped 18 points, or 0.18 percent, to 10,233. At the forex market, the rupee also depreciated 11 paise, to 73 rupees and 55 paise against the US dollar.

Sensex declines 181 points; Nifty closes at 10,245

Benchmark Domestic stocks on Monday closed with losses for third straight session amid positive global markets.  Sensex at Bombay Stock Exchange declined 181 points or 0.53 percent to 34,134.  The Nifty at the National Stock Exchange also fell 58 points or 0.57 percent to 10,245.

Sensex climbs 732 points to 34,734, Nifty also surges 238 to 10,473

Benchmark domestic stocks today bounced back strongly and recovered from big losses of previous session after European and other Asian shares logged positive trade. Rupee also registered a strong recovery. Sensex at the Bombay Stock Exchange climbed 732 points or 2.15 percent to 34,734. The Nifty at the National Stock Exchange also surged 238 points or 2.32 percent to 10,473.  The rupee also logged strong recovery as it appreciated 56 paise to end of 73 rupees 56 paise against the US dollar. Sensex dips 806 points; Rupee hits new low

Benchmark domestic stocks today nosedived more than two percent amid falling rupee, crude prices hike and negative global cues.  Sensex at the Bombay Stock Exchange fell 806 points or 2.24 percent to 35,169.  The Nifty at the National Stock Exchange also slipped 259 points or 2.39 percent to 10,599.

Rupee hit new low of Rs 73.77 against US dollar

The Rupee hit a new low against the US dollar today. It plunged 43 paise to 73 rupees and 77 paise against the American currency. The Sensex at the Bombay Stock Exchange tanked 756 points to trade at 35,219 a short while ago. The Nifty was also down 242 points at 10,616.

Sensex falls 509 points

The benchmark domestic stocks today plunged more than one per cent for the second day this week amid mixed global share markets.  Sensex at the Bombay Stock Exchange lost 1.34 per cent or 509 points to 37,413.  The Nifty at the National Stock Exchange also tumbled 1.32 per cent or 151 points to 11,288.  In secondary indices at BSE, Mid Cap plunged 1.36 per cent while Small Cap index also fell sharply by 1.37 per cent.
